Sunderland stunned Everton 3-1 on Sunday, dealing a hammer blow to the Toffees' European ambitions in a dramatic second-half turnaround. Isidor's cool counter-attack finish deep in stoppage time was the moment that truly summed up the visitors' dominance. Everton had gone ahead just before the break when Merlin Röhl's shot deflected off Xhaka and looped over goalkeeper Roefs in the 43rd minute. Sunderland hit back emphatically after the interval — Brian Brobbey levelled in the 59th minute after Jake O'Brien gifted possession, and Enzo Le Fee bundled home past Pickford in the 81st to put the visitors in front. Isidor struck again in the 90+1' to seal a commanding win. The defeat leaves Everton's European hopes hanging by a thread, with Brighton, Brentford, and Chelsea all ahead in the race for the final continental spot. For Sunderland, in their first season back in the Premier League, it's a statement result that caps a truly impressive return to the top flight.
